Daphni

Daphni, established in 2015, is a Paris-based venture capital firm that invests in technology startups across Europe. It focuses on user-oriented companies with a strong European foundation and global aspirations. Daphni is supported by Daphnipolis, a community of over 200 entrepreneurs, executives, and advisors, and a digital platform for efficient and transparent operations.

Underdog

Series A in 2025
Underdog operates an online platform that specializes in selling refurbished household appliances. The company focuses on providing pre-owned items that have been diagnosed, repaired, cleaned, and thoroughly tested to ensure quality. Each appliance comes with a warranty, allowing customers to purchase with confidence. Underdog aims to promote recycling and sustainable consumption by offering affordable, professionally checked appliances, thereby encouraging a more eco-friendly approach to home goods.

Hubcycle

Series A in 2024
Hubcycle specializes in upcycling food ingredients by transforming industrial waste into valuable raw materials. The company focuses on segregating plant-based waste and selecting high-value side streams for reuse, thereby creating new sustainable ingredients tailored to consumer needs. By establishing innovative value chains, Hubcycle enables industries to participate in the circular economy, significantly reducing the environmental impact of commercial processes. Through its efforts, Hubcycle aims to provide high-performance and sustainable solutions that benefit both the environment and the market.

Voltfang

Series A in 2024
Voltfang specializes in developing sustainable home storage solutions by utilizing recycled traction batteries from electric vehicles. The company repurposes used electric car batteries, integrating them into stationary storage systems that create a decentralized energy storage network. This approach not only extends the lifespan of these batteries after their automotive use but also provides small and medium-sized enterprises with the capability to store renewable energy. As a result, Voltfang's systems help stabilize the energy grid through techniques like peak shaving and load shifting, ultimately enabling clients to minimize their ecological footprint and contribute to environmental conservation efforts.

GEEV

Venture Round in 2024
GEEV is a mobile application that facilitates the donation and collection of various objects among its users, promoting a collaborative anti-waste initiative. It allows members to either give away items they no longer need or to obtain free objects from others, thereby encouraging sustainable practices and reducing waste. The platform includes features that enable users to communicate easily, arrange meetings, and effectively exchange items, fostering a community-driven approach to sharing resources. By connecting individuals who wish to donate with those seeking to obtain, GEEV aims to give a second life to usable items while minimizing environmental impact.

Save Market

Seed Round in 2021
Save Market operates a marketplace focused on consumer electronics, specifically designed to address the challenges associated with electronic waste. The company has developed an electronic repurchasing platform that streamlines the processes of logistics, recovery, reconditioning, and reintegration of electronic equipment. By providing a transparent and efficient technology solution, Save Market enables organizations to improve their purchasing capabilities for new equipment while adopting environmentally sustainable practices. This approach not only facilitates better management of electronic assets but also supports the reduction of waste in the electronics industry.
